Output 95867b26c32f978e3f43ad622b53267a73c57bf1fe4246560da22f8b553041a5:1

value
19594504
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3676f2ba5befedde4e70299ee33e77ea393bbbd1 OP_EQUALVERIFY OP_CHECKSIG
address
LQBwFEZZAUBtpKzVnXiNPQAjRqa6QjUKvo
transaction
95867b26c32f978e3f43ad622b53267a73c57bf1fe4246560da22f8b553041a5
spent
true